Essential Attributes of Network Management AI Tools

AI GPTs for Network Management stand out for their adaptability and multifunctionality. These tools can scale from performing basic network diagnostics to executing complex optimization algorithms. Key features include real-time network performance monitoring, predictive analytics for preemptive troubleshooting, automated incident response, and security threat detection. They also offer natural language processing for interpreting technical documentation and user queries, alongside data analysis capabilities for generating insights from vast amounts of network data. This adaptability ensures that network managers can rely on AI GPTs to meet both current and future network challenges.
